FAQs: Travel from Rimini to Naples

Travel to Naples eas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Rimini to Naples.

FAQs
There are 2 options to travel between Rimini and Naples including taking a train and bus.
The cheapest way to travel from Rimini to Naples is a bus with an average price of $55 (€45).

This is compared to other travel options from Rimini to Naples:

A bus is $0.68 (€0.55) less than a train for this route with tickets for a train from Rimini to Naples costing on average $56 (€45).

The fastest way to travel from Rimini to Naples is by train with an average journey time of 6h 53m.

Other travel options to Naples take longer:

Bus takes on average 9h 13m.

The distance from Rimini to Naples is approximately 238 miles (384 km).
The average frequency per day from Rimini to Naples is:
  • Around 25 trains per day.
  • Around 10 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Rimini and Naples as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Rimini to Naples:
  • Trains mostly depart from Rimini station and arrive in Naples Centrale.
  • Buses mostly depart from Rimini, Centro Studi (Via Fada) and arrive in Naples, Metropark Centrale(Terminal Bus FS Park).

Most travelers need at least three days in Naples to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Naples, you can stroll through Spaccanapoli to experience local life, enjoy authentic Neapolitan pizza, and explore the Catacombs of San Gennaro. Visit the bustling Pignasecca markets and relax at the scenic Naples waterfront. Don't miss the Pompeii Archaeological Site, the Naples National Archaeological Museum, Castel dell'Ovo, the stunning Naples Cathedral, and the historic Royal Palace of Naples.
To fully experience Naples, consider spending 3 to 4 days exploring its historic sites, vibrant neighborhoods, and nearby attractions like Pompeii and the Amalfi Coast.
